Job Title:
Software Developer (Developer/Programmer Analyst 3)
Location:
100% Remote
Employment Type:
Full-Time
Position Overview
Optimized Technical Solutions (OTS) is seeking highly skilled
Software Developers
to join our team in supporting the modernization and enhancement of mission-critical financial and reporting applications. This role will focus on building scalable, high-performance solutions using modern Microsoft technologies, including
.NET 8.0/9.0, Blazor, and Oracle databases , while collaborating with cross-functional teams in an Agile/SCRUM environment.
Responsibilities
Design, develop, and implement a modern reporting framework using .NET 8.0/9.0 and Blazor.
Analyze, optimize, and enhance existing Crystal Reports integrated with Oracle databases.
Build and maintain scalable, high-performance financial system solutions.
Collaborate with DevOps teams to improve CI/CD pipelines and automation processes.
Participate in the full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C) using Agile methodologies.
Provide innovative solutions to modernize legacy systems in alignment with business objectives.
Required Qualifications
8+ years
of experience with SDLC, Entity Framework, Oracle (PL/SQL, stored procedures, performance tuning), and design principles.
6+ years
of experience with Blazor Server/WSM and Fluent UI.
5+ years
of experience with Bitbucket, Nomad, and Consul.
2+ years
of experience with .NET 8.0/9.0, C#, and Visual Studio.
Strong knowledge of data modeling, ETL processes, and reporting frameworks.
Proven ability to work within SCRUM/Agile environments and CI/CD pipelines.
Preferred Qualifications
Experience with JIRA, TEMPO, Bitbucket, Confluence, and similar tools.
Familiarity with Texas State Agencies or government environments (3+ years preferred).
